Building Management System Security
Protecting your property's Building Control System (BMS) is essential in today's online landscape. A thorough BMS digital safety checklist is your initial defense against potential threats . Here's a essential overview of key areas :
- Inspect device configurations often.
- Enforce strong credentials and two-factor verification.
- Isolate your system environment from other networks.
- Keep system firmware patched with the most recent security releases.
- Track control signals for suspicious behavior.
- Conduct periodic security assessments .
- Train personnel on BMS security best guidelines.
By adhering to this basic checklist, you can substantially lower the possibility of a cyber incident.
